Abstract (EN)

Objective: Familial Mediterranean Fever (FMF) is the most common autoinflammatory diseases, including in Turkey, is a major health problem in countries bordering the eastern Mediterranean. The aim of this study was to evaluate possible tissue stiffness changes in the liver and spleen in adult FMF patients with shear wave elastography (SWE) and to evaluate its usability as an additional advantage in clinical follow-up. Materials and Methods: Seventy five adult FMF patients and 73 adult healty volunteers were included in the study. Patients were examined by 2-D SWE method through the intercostal space where the liver and spleen could be clearly seen. Parenchymal stiffness of the liver and spleen was measured in kPa as the stiffness value. The differences between the stiffness values of the liver and spleen between the two groups were examined. Results: Liver stiffness value (LSV) was found to be statistically significantly higher in the group with FMF. Although the spleen stiffness value (SSV) was found higher in the group with FMF, the difference between the groups is not statistically significant. Conclusions: In the future, the increase in stiffness in the liver parenchyma in patients with FMF can be quantitatively demonstrated by the 2-D SWE method, and SWE can be used as an auxiliary imaging method in the follow-up of patients with FMF for this purpose. The LSV and SSV measurements obtained in the current study can be used as reference stiffness values for both the control and FMF.
